Tour of Britain – Cornwall Stage

Not long now until 5th September and the first stage of the Tour of Britain – featuring our patron Chris Opie (along with Mark Cavendish, Wout van Aert and other stars).  The race is due to pass through Truro at approximately 13.46, and Truro BID and Truro City Council have partnered with the Old Bakery Studios to stage a one-day free event celebrating the race. From 11.30am, Lemon Quay will play host to live music, Mountain Bike Stunt Shows, a bicycle art station, performers, DJs, street food and a bar.  We will be sharing a stand on the Quay with Truro Cycling Campaign and would be hugely grateful if you could spare an hour or two to help.  Please contact Paul if you can help.

West Kernow Way

Unlock the fascinating history and breathtaking beauty of the ancient kingdom of Kernow on this 230km ride around the tip of Cornwall.

The West Kernow Way is Cycling UK's latest long-distance route which will be ready to ride on 3 September 2021. Designed to be ridden over three to four days, the off road trail begins and ends in Penzance, and will take in many of the highlights of the western half of the Cornish peninsula, including the Botallack tin mines, Land’s End, St Michael’s Mount and Lizard Point.
